ActionScript 3.0, Adobe Flex, Tools

ItDepends : A tool for visually exploring the dependencies between classes and packages in an Adobe Flex application

Currently I am converting an existing application with about 3.500+ classes to use RSL’s. It’s proven to be rather difficult because we are using a lot of different libraries and modules with quite a number of dependencies between libraries. Despite no libraries having direct circular dependency, there are some indirect dependency-circles in the system.

When moving to a RSL-based architecture it becomes extremely important to understand the class-definitions included in each library and modules.. and more importantly to know exactly when they are both loaded, needed and used.

ItDepends is a tool for visually exploring the dependencies between classes and packages in an Adobe Flex application.
It’s a great aid when undertaking my task, but even during the normal development of modular applications it can be valuable to use it when considering how to break up the application to increase performance as well as general system quality.

Check it out…
http://code.google.com/p/it-depends/

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s